Charaf Moulali

Charaf has been working in the humanitarian field for over 20 years, from leading field operations to managing an international child rights-based organization covering 12 countries in Africa, Middle East and South East Asia. He has wide-ranging field experience in emergency, post-conflict and development programmes as country director for non-governmental organisations in Iraq, Myanmar, Sudan; head of UN offices in Libya and Iraq; and as a senior protection advisor with the United Nations in Sudan, Iraq and Central African Republic. Charaf holds a master’s degree in economics and management and a post-graduate diploma in social changes and development.
